Affiliated Company: Thermo Fisher Scientific Inc. Department/Organization Name: Corporate Strategy & Marketing Corporate Marketing Marketing Communications Specialist Job Band: 5 Number of Subordinates: None Job Purpose The Corporate Marketing Department's mission is to provide high-quality customer experiences at every customer touchpoint by utilizing both online and offline channels. In addition to producing product materials and supporting event operations, we implement a wide range of marketing initiatives such as newsletters, websites, social media, and digital advertising, promoting continuous relationship building and engagement with customers. By deploying marketing programs planned both domestically and internationally through optimal channels and maximizing their effectiveness, we contribute to enhancing brand recognition and generating leads for our products and services. Furthermore, we execute valuable proposals that lead to solving customer issues in close collaboration with related departments such as product marketing, customer support, and technical services. As a specialized marketing organization, we provide advice and support regarding the use of various channels and regulations, and by setting and achieving specific and measurable goals, we robustly support business growth. Job Responsibilities You will perform practical duties as a marketing promotion staff member within the marketing communications team. You will consider the overall request details (purpose, priority, cost, desired delivery date, request volume, difficulty) and manage production progress and project management to meet quality, cost, and delivery deadlines. You will explain the production flow to requesters and present necessary preparations to ensure smooth progress and complete the tasks. You will accurately understand our brand guidelines and explain the necessary guidelines for promotions to internal stakeholders and production-related vendors with supporting evidence. You will continuously seek improvement opportunities in existing workflows and contribute to productivity enhancement and risk reduction by proposing and executing improvement opportunities.
- More than 3 years of experience in marketing communications - Experience in project management for production with internal and external stakeholders - Native-level proficiency in Japanese and English (reading guidelines, email correspondence) - Excellent writing skills - Practical experience with Microsoft Office
- Project management experience - People management experience - Digital marketing experience - TOEIC score equivalent to 750 or higher
- This position allows you to promote marketing across multiple departments in a cross-functional manner. There are also career paths expected in marketing strategy and management in the future. - There are 3 managers and 6 members, with a wide range of ages from 20s to 50s. - Many members have joined from outside the industry, and product knowledge can be caught up after joining.
